The Timeless Appeal Of Hessian Blinds

When it comes to window treatments, hessian blinds have a timeless appeal that can add a touch of natural elegance to any room. Also known as burlap blinds, these window coverings are made from a coarse woven fabric that is known for its durability and unique texture. The rustic look of hessian blinds can complement a wide range of interior styles, from country chic to modern farmhouse. In this article, we will explore the history of hessian blinds, their benefits, and how to incorporate them into your home decor.

hessian blinds have been around for centuries and were originally used as practical window coverings in agricultural and industrial settings. The rugged, natural material was well-suited for protecting interiors from harsh sunlight, dust, and prying eyes. Over time, hessian blinds grew in popularity for their simple yet stylish appearance, and they soon found their way into residential interiors.

One of the key benefits of hessian blinds is their versatility. The neutral, earthy tone of the fabric makes it easy to coordinate with a wide range of color palettes. Whether you prefer a minimalist, monochromatic look or a cozy, eclectic vibe, hessian blinds can complement your decor effortlessly. Their natural texture adds warmth and depth to a room, creating a cozy atmosphere that is inviting and comfortable.

In addition to their aesthetic appeal, hessian blinds offer practical benefits as well. The thick, woven fabric provides excellent insulation, helping to regulate the temperature inside your home. During the hot summer months, hessian blinds can keep your room cool by blocking out the sun’s harsh rays. In the winter, they can help to trap heat inside, reducing your energy bills and keeping your home cozy and warm.

Another advantage of hessian blinds is their durability. Unlike flimsy paper blinds or delicate fabric curtains, hessian blinds are built to last. The rugged fabric can withstand daily wear and tear, making them a practical choice for high-traffic areas like living rooms, kitchens, and children’s rooms. With proper care and maintenance, hessian blinds can retain their beauty and functionality for years to come, making them a wise investment for your home.

hessian blinds can also be customized to suit your preferences and needs. Whether you prefer a roll-up style or a Roman shade design, hessian blinds can be tailored to fit your windows perfectly. Choose from a range of hardware options, including cordless mechanisms for a clean, streamlined look. You can even add blackout lining to your hessian blinds for added privacy and light control, making them a practical choice for bedrooms and media rooms.
